Foolproof Spinach and Feta Frittata

Preheat oven to 350.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ium high heat. Saute spinach until wilted, and then transfer to a 10 inch oven-safe skillet (I use my cast iron skillet ). Beat eggs until frothy and pour over spinach. Crumble feta and sprinkle over eggs. Season with a pinch of salt and a grinding of pepper.

Recipe ingredients This spinach frittata recipe can be customized a number of ways based on what ingredients you have on hand. Eggs. You'll need 8 large eggs for this spinach feta frittata. Baby spinach. There is a whopping 4-5 ounces of baby spinach in this recipe, which sounds like a lot, but it cooks down considerably.
